What happens on the day

Your root canal, step by step

No surprises. Here is exactly what your appointment involves, from the moment you sit down to the moment you leave.

1. Digital diagnosis

Included in your consultation

A low-dose digital X-ray shows us the shape of the roots and how far the infection has spread, so there are no surprises once we begin.

2. Complete numbing

Sedation available

Numbing gel first, then a modern long-acting anaesthetic. We do not start until you confirm the tooth is completely numb. Sedation is available if you are anxious.

3. Cleaning the canals

The main part, about 45 min

The infected pulp is removed and each canal is cleaned, disinfected and shaped with rotary instruments under a protective rubber dam.

4. Sealing the tooth

Same appointment

The cleaned canals are filled with a biocompatible material and sealed, which stops bacteria getting back in and re-infecting the tooth.

5. Crown protection

From $795 when needed

Back teeth take heavy chewing forces, so we usually recommend a crown afterwards. It protects the tooth and is colour-matched to sit invisibly in your smile.

Extraction is quicker and cheaper on the day, but it leaves a gap that affects chewing and lets neighbouring teeth drift. Replacing the tooth with an implant typically costs three to four times more than saving it. Where a tooth is restorable, keeping your own is almost always the better long-term decision — and we will tell you honestly when it is not.
